본 고안은 자동차 타이어를 공기 튜우브 없이 내부에 장착하는 탄발 스프링의 탄지 작용으로 타이어 작용이 되도록 한 것에 있어 그 구성물을 타이어 본체 안에 손쉽게 장설할 수 있게 함과 아울러 내부 구조를 수리도 할 수 있도록 한 것이다.The present invention is to make the tire action by the action of the elastic spring of the car tire mounted inside the tire without the air tube, so that the components can be easily installed in the tire body and the internal structure can be repaired. will be.

종래에 공기 튜우브 없이 골격판을 타이어 본체에 매설하여 타이어 작용을 하도록 한 것을 개량하여 탄발스프링의 쿳숀 작용으로 원활한 타이어 작용을 하게 구성 장치를 타이어 본체에 손쉽게 장설 및 수리하여 실사용 가치가 높은 공기 튜우브 없는 자동차 타이어를 고안한 것인 바 이를 첨부 도면에 의거하여 상세히 설명하면 다음과 같다.In the past, the skeleton plate was embedded in the tire body without the air tube, and the tire action was performed to smooth the tire action by the cushioning action of the tan-spring. The invention will be described in detail with reference to the accompanying drawings, a tire without a tubing car bar as follows.

타이어 본체 외주부(1)와 타이어 본체 내주부 (2)의 각 내면에 간극(6)을 두어 외주부 판체(3)와 내주부 판체(4)를 배설하여 스프링 괘지간 (4'), (3')를 돌설한 외주부 판체(3)와 내주부 판체(4)에 탄발 스프링(5)을 장설한 것에 있어서 타이어본체의 측면을 개구되게 하여 덮개판체(7)를 떼어 낼수 있게 하였다.A gap 6 is provided on each inner surface of the tire main body outer periphery 1 and the tire main body inner periphery 2 to provide an outer peripheral plate 3 and an inner peripheral plate 4 for the spring restraint 4 ', (3'). In the case where the carbon springs 5 were installed in the outer circumferential plate body 3 and the inner circumferential plate body 4 which protruded, the side surface of the tire body was opened so that the cover plate body 7 could be removed.

이와 같이 된 본 고안은 덮개판체(7)를 열어서 타이어 측면 개구부를 통하여 외주부 판체(3) 및 내부주 판체(4)와 탄발스프링(5)의 장착을 하거나 또한 그 일부분의 수리 작업 등을 할 수 있게 되며 자동차 주행시 타이어에 하중이 가해지는 타이어 본체 외주부 (1) 내면의 외주부 판체 (3) 및 그 양편의 외주부 판체 (3)에 가해지면서 그 이음부위의 탄발 스피링 (5)이 탄지 작용을 하게 되어 타이어로서의 작용을 하게 되며 타이어가 회전함에 따라 연속 되는 외주부판체 (3) 및 탄발스프링 (5)은 탄지 작용을 속행하게 되어 공기 튜우브를 장설한 타이어와 동일한 주행을 하게 되면서 타이어 펑크 발생이 전연 생기지 않는 효과를 거두게 되는 것이다.According to the present invention, the cover plate 7 can be opened to mount the outer circumferential plate 3 and the inner circumferential plate 4 and the tanval spring 5 through the tire side opening, or to repair a part thereof. It is applied to the outer circumferential plate body 3 on the inner surface of the tire main body outer circumferential part 1 and the outer circumferential plate body 3 on both sides of the tire body when the vehicle is loaded, and the elastic springs 5 at the joints are supported. As the tire rotates, the outer periphery plate body 3 and the tanval spring 5 continue to carry out the fingering action, and the tire puncture occurs as the tire travels with the air tubing. The effect does not occur.
